Dollar Bill (group)
Dollar Bill is a Swedish hip-hop group from Rosengård (Malmö County), Sweden established in 2002, and made up of Tax (real name Muhammed Ahmadi), The Beast (real name Besfort Sulejmani) and their friend Edo (real name Eldin Telalovic). Jassim "Jask" Ahmadi, Tax's brother, was a former group member, but left in 2014 for his job. Isen "Ice" Sulejmani (The Beast's brother) is another past member; he was left out of the formation in 2006 because the group wanted a more serious image. After putting out materials online via their MySpace account, they released their debut album ''Återfödelsen'' with collaborations from Gonza, Herbert Munkhammar, Afasi, Organism12, Masse, Keione, AFC, Timbuktu (musician), Timbuktu, Chords, Hosam (from Highwon), Avastyle and Rock-a-spot. They have appeared in a number of shows, notably ''Nyhetsmorgon'', and at festivals like Malmöfestivalen. Rosengård
Rosengård (literally "Rose Manor") was a city district ( sv, stadsdel) in the center of Malmö Municipality, Sweden. On 1 July 2013, it was merged with Husie, forming Öster. In 2012, Rosengård had a population of 23,563 of the municipality's 307,758. Its area was 332 hectares. Rosengård is often incorrectly referred to as a suburb, although the area is located centrally in Malmö, neighbouring the former city district Centrum. Long a destination for immigrants, 86% of the population had some foreign ancestry in 2008. History Most of Rosengård was built between 1967 and 1972 as a part of the Million Programme although some parts, such as the mansion in Herrgården, and Östra kyrkogården, are older. Rosengård is to a high degree populated by minorities. In 1972, the percentage of immigrants was around 18%, with the majority of inhabitants being working-class people from rural Sweden.
